There are many private colleges that participate in WBJEE counselling. Some popular private colleges that will accept students based on their WBJEE scores are Heritage Institute of Technology, Techno India University, Haldia Institute of Technology, and more. Yes, there a self-financing institutes included in the WBJEE counselling process. In the self-financing institutes, the 10% approved seats will be open for JEE Main qualified candidates. These students do not require WBJEE scores for admission.

WBJEE is conducted annually to select eligible students for admission. The students are allotted into the BTech and BPharm Government and Self-financing institutes of the state of West Bengal. For admissions into these institutes, WBJEE scores are accepted, with a small percentage of seats reserved for JEE Main candidates.

No, the students will not be allowed to change their allotted WBJEE exam centre. Since the exam centre is allotted after checking the students' submitted preference, the authorities will not accept requests for the same. Students are advised to choose their preferences carefully.

To download WBJEE admit card, students will have to log in using their application form number and date of birth. The hall ticket will not be available in any other mode. After admit card is released, students will have to print it as it will be needed at exam centre.
